When the current buffer becomes full, nlmsg_put() in dsa_slave_port_fdb_do_dump() returns -EMSGSIZE and DSA saves the index of the last dumped FDB entry, returns to rtnl_fdb_dump() up to that point, and then the dump resumes on the same port with a new skb, and FDB entries up to the saved index are simply skipped. Since dsa_slave_port_fdb_do_dump() is pointed to by the "cb" passed to drivers, then drivers must check for the -EMSGSIZE error code returned by it. Otherwise, when a netlink skb becomes full, DSA will no longer save newly dumped FDB entries to it, but the driver will continue dumping. So FDB entries will be missing from the dump. Fix the broken backpressure by propagating the "cb" return code and allow rtnl_fdb_dump() to restart the FDB dump with a new skb.
